Happy October, all! I’m excited to share a pleasant surprise that I received last night when I shimmied down the magazine aisle at Borders and picked up a Venus Zine to peruse with my chilled coffee concoction:

J.Lynne Cosmetics in Venus Zine!

See that circled goody in the lower left corner? That’s an Ultra Intensity Eyeliner from my own indie beauty company, J.Lynne Cosmetics! *Does mental happy dance to a kickin’ Jamiroquai tune.*

I had been contacted a few months back and was asked to send a few high-res photos of my eyeliners, but I hadn’t really thought about it since. Talk about a treat! It just goes to show that you don’t necessarily need a PR company, professional photography, lots of marketing know-how, etc. to create some buzz. Those things are a great help, absolutely, but I think a grass-roots approach can really go far, especially when you’re first starting out. I’m not sure where the Venus Zine gal heard about us, but we received some great blog mentions earlier this year, so those certainly could have contributed. The Daily Bite: Catia Chien

Catia Chien

Southern California’s Catia Chien is an accomplished painter and talented artist who mixes whimsical imagery with rich colors, creating a style that’s both vibrant and serene. She’s currently focusing her talents on the children’s book market, comic book anthologies, and galleries — but you can snag prints, postcards, and stationary sets through her website. Catia’s beautiful work is not to be missed!

Kate McInnes and Sean Kelly are the creative and artistic forces behind LoungeKat and Bucket O’ Thought. Their unique and edgy artwork has been used for various different applications such as skateboards, t-shirts, limited edition prints and custom toys.
